Here's mine. Cost me all of $45 and that's because I picked up a spare speedo housing on Ebay for $35.
Just replaced the front tank bolt with a 6 inch grade 5 bolt. Added a 2 inch spacer and bolted on the Autometer 3209 bracket.
Chopped off the speedo housing with a band saw and painted it.
Pretty quick and easy to do.
